    Notizen: Abstract. One of the major goals in physical chemistry is to obtain a microscopic understanding of chemical reactions. Recent developments in femtosecond laser techniques provide the opportunity to resolve the timescale of elementary steps of chemical reactions at surfaces. This is exemplified for the femtosecond laser-induced oxidation of CO on Ru(001). Among other adsorbate-specific probes vibrational sum-frequency generation spectroscopy offers the possibility to monitor adsorbates or reaction intermediates directly at the surface. Recently, we have employed this technique to investigate the dynamics of the CO-stretch vibration of CO adsorbed on Ru(001) after optical excitation leading to CO desorption.

    Notizen: Irradiation of a Ru(001) surface covered with CO using intense femtosecond laser pulses (800 nm, 130 fs) leads to desorption of CO with a nonlinear dependence of the yield on the absorbed fluence (100–380 J/m2). Two-pulse correlation measurements reveal a response time of 20 ps (FWHM). The lack of an isotope effect together with the strong rise of the phonon temperature (2500 K) and the specific electronic structure of the adsorbate–substrate system strongly indicate that coupling to phonons is dominant. The experimental findings can be well reproduced within a friction-coupled heat bath model. Yet, pronounced dynamical cooling in desorption, found in the fluence-dependence of the translational energy, and in a non-Arrhenius behavior of the desorption probability reflect pronounced deviations from thermal equilibrium during desorption taking place on such a short time scale. © 2000 American Institute of Physics.

    Notizen: Summary.  Routine infusions of factor VIII to prevent bleeding, known as prophylaxis, and other intensive therapies are being more broadly applied to patients with haemophilia. These therapies differ widely in replacement product usage, cost, frequency of venous access and parental effort. In order to address residual issues relating to recommendations, implementation, and evaluations of prophylaxis therapy in persons with haemophila, a multinational working group was formed and called the International Prophylaxis Study Group (IPSG). The group was comprised of haemophilia treaters actively involved in studies of prophylaxis from North America and Europe. Two expert committees, the Physical Therapy (PT) Working Group and the Magnetic Resonance Imaging (MRI) Working Group were organized to critically assess existing tools for assessment of joint outcome. These two committees independently concluded that the WFH Physical Examination Scale (WFH PE Scale) and the WFH X-ray Scale (WFH XR Scale) were inadequately sensitive to detect early changes in joints. New scales were developed based on suggested modifications of the existing scales and called the Haemophilia Joint Health Score (HJHS) and the International MRI Scales. The new scales were piloted. Concordance was measured by the intra-class correlation coefficient of variation. Reliability of the HJHS was excellent with an inter-observer co-efficient of 0.83 and a test-retest value of 0.89. The MRI study was conducted using both Denver and European scoring approaches; inter-reader reliability using the two approaches was 0.88 and 0.87; test-retest reliability was 0.92 and 0.93. These new PT and MRI scales promise to improve outcome assessment in children on early preventive treatment regimens.

    Beschreibung / Inhaltsverzeichnis: Polarization of sand soils in cathodic protectionDuring the measurement of pipeline potentials to verify cathodic protection, the observation was made that direct current voltage persists in high-resistivity sand soil when the cathodic protection system is switched off. This observation is conformed by laboratory tests and is not in agreement with current theory and previous measurements. The polarization of heterogenous electrolytes was studied by tests made with cleaned fine gravel and sand; in some tests, de-ionized water, sodium chloride, colloidal silicon dioxide or clay were added. Tests showed that polarization is essentially restricted to pure silica sand granules. This would mean that polarization will only occur in high-resistivity sand (containing practically no salt) which will no cause corrosion.
    Notizen: Bei der Potentialmessung an Rohrleitungen zur Beurteilung des kathodischen Korrosionsschutzes wurde beobachtet, daß in Sandböden hohen elektrischen Widerstandes auch nach Abschalten des Schutzstromes elektrische Gleichspannungen bestehen bleiben. Diese Erscheinung wird durch Laboruntersuchungen bestätigt und steht im Widerspruch zu bisherigen theoretischen Annahmen und praktischen Messungen. Die polarisierbarkeit heterogener Elektrolytmedien wird an chemisch gereinigtem Feinkies bzw. Sand ermittelt, auch unter Zusatz von entionisiertem Wasser, Natriumchlorid, lolloidalem Siliziumdioxid und Ton. Die Untersuchungen zeigen, daß die Polarisierbarkeit im wesentlichen auf reine Quarzkörner begrenzt ist. Danach ist eine Polarisation nur für hochohmige, nahezu salzfreie Sandböden zu erwarten, in denen keine Korrosionsgefährdung besteht.
